I'm not sure if this should be posted in the "Christian" section or not, but whatever..


Klayton announced this today on his new Circle of Dust Facebook page


"Since you guys are in this small, underground "Circle of Dust" club, I'll let you in on a secret: I had an idea today that will make a few of you pretty happy. 2016 may shape up to be more than just the re-release of all my old albums with a *couple* of new tracks. Yeah, I'm thinking maybe more than a couple would be a better idea...."


It looks like Klayton will release a NEW CoD record in 2016 along with re-releasing all 3 Circle of Dust records with improved sound quality, unreleased tracks and some re-records possibly. This is the best news I've heard from Klayton. I miss his guitar heavy music and I'm glad he does too.
